    General Description of Collection: The Community Reinvestment Act 
regulation requires the FDIC to assess the record of banks and thrifts 
in helping meet the credit needs of their entire communities, including 
low- and moderate-income neighborhoods, consistent with safe and sound 
operations; and to take this record into account in evaluating 
applications for mergers, branches, and certain other corporate 
activities.
    There is no change in the method or substance of the collection. 
The overall increase in burden hours is a result of an increase in the 
number of Small Banks electing to voluntarily respond in certain 
categories. The increase is also, in small part, due to an adjustment 
in the agency's estimate of the time required to submit strategic plan 
applications from 275 hours per respondent to 400 hours per respondent.
    2. Title: Affiliate Marketing Consumer Opt-Out Notices.
    OMB Number: 3064-0149.
    Form Number: None.
    Affected Public: Insured state nonmember banks, state savings 
associations that have affiliates and consumers that have a 
relationship with the foregoing.

\1\ According to data from the Federal Reserve's National Information Center (NIC), there were 3,063 FDIC
  supervised institutions with an affiliate as of March 31st, 2017. This is an increase of 23 institutions from
  March 31st, 2014, which had 3,040 institutions with affiliates. Based on the research and NIC data, it is
  reasonable to estimate that the population of institutions with affiliates will continue to grow by
  approximately 23 institutions over the next three years. Thus, FDIC anticipates approximately 8 institutions
  per year will have an implementation burden.
\2\ The number of respondents facing ongoing burden remains unchanged at 990.
\3\ The FDIC estimates that 95.4% of the 990 banks impacted by this information collection are community banks
  having an average of 12,098 consumers and the remaining 4.6% are non-community (larger) banks having an
  average of 124,745 consumers. The FDIC estimates that 5% of the 17,140,540 estimated consumers at these 990
  institutions (857,027 consumers) elect to Opt-Out of affiliate marketing information sharing.

    General Description of Collection: Section 214 of the FACT Act 
requires financial institutions that wish to share information about 
consumers with their affiliates, to inform such consumers that they 
have the opportunity to opt out of such marketing solicitations. The 
disclosure notices and consumer responses thereto comprise the elements 
of this collection of information.
    There is no change in the method or substance of this information 
collection. There has been a net increase in the estimated total annual 
burden primarily because of an upward adjustment in the agency's 
estimate of the number of consumers at FDIC-supervised institutions 
that elect to opt-out of affiliate marketing information sharing. The 
increase in burden due to the adjustment in the estimated number of 
consumers affected was offset by the fact that most banks have 
completed the implementation phase of the information collection; the 
estimated ongoing time per response for most affected institutions 
decreasing from 18 hours at implementation to 2 hours ongoing.
    3. Title: Retail Foreign Exchange Transactions.
    OMB Number: 3064-0182.
    Form Number: None.
    Affected Public: Insured state nonmember banks and state savings 
associations.

    General Description of Collection: This information collection 
implements section 742(c)(2) of the Dodd-Frank Act (7 U.S.C. 2(c)(2)(E) 
and FDIC regulations governing retail foreign exchange transactions as 
set forth at 12 CFR part 349, subpart B. The regulation allows banking 
organizations under FDIC supervision to engage in off-exchange 
transactions in foreign currency with retail customers provided they 
comply with various reporting, recordkeeping and third-party disclosure 
requirements specified in the rule. If an institution elects to conduct 
such transactions, compliance with the information collection is 
mandatory.
    Reporting Requirements--Part 349, subpart B requires that, prior to 
initiating a retail foreign exchange business; a banking institution 
must provide the FDIC with a notice certifying that the institution has 
written policies and procedures, and risk measurement and management 
systems and controls in place to ensure that retail foreign exchange 
transactions are conducted in a safe and sound manner. The institution 
must also provide information about it intends to manage customer due 
diligence, new product approvals and haircuts applied to noncash 
margin.
    Recordkeeping Requirements--Part 349 subpart B requires that 
institutions engaging in retail foreign exchange transactions keep 
full, complete and systematic records of account, financial ledger, 
transaction, memorandum orders and post execution allocations of 
bunched orders. In addition, institutions are required to maintain 
records regarding their ratio of profitable accounts, possible 
violations of law, records of noncash margin and monthly statements and 
confirmations issued.
    Disclosure Requirements--The regulation requires that, before 
opening an account that will engage in retail foreign exchange 
transactions, a banking institution must obtain from each retail 
foreign exchange customer an acknowledgement of receipt and 
understanding of a written disclosure specified in the rule and of 
disclosures about the banking institution's fees and other charges and 
of its profitable accounts ratio. The institution must also provide 
monthly statements to each retail foreign exchange customer and must 
send confirmation statements following every transaction. The customer 
dispute resolution provisions of the regulation require certain 
endorsements, acknowledgements and signature language as well as the 
timely provision of a list of persons qualified to handle a customer's 
request for arbitration.
    There is no change in the method or substance of the collection. At 
present no FDIC-supervised institution is engaging in activities that 
would make them subject to the information collection requirements. 
FDIC originally estimated that 3 institutions would be impacted by the 
rule. The agency is reducing the estimated number of respondents to one 
(1) as a placeholder in case an institution elects to engage in covered 
activities in the future. There has been no change in the frequency of 
response or in the estimated number of hours required to respond. 
Because of the reduction in the estimated number of respondents from 
three (3) to one (1), the estimated annual burden has decreased.
